Noun[edit]

tawk (countable and uncountable, plural tawks)

  1. Eye dialect spelling of talk, representing New York City English.

Verb[edit]

tawk (third-person singular simple present tawks, present participle tawking, simple past and past participle tawked)

  1. Eye dialect spelling of talk, representing New York City English.
